Clothing and Footwear
Stylish OOTDs for All Occasions
You can’t be that guy repeating shirts in every pic. Not cool, bro. Pack:
▢ Breathable shirts and tank tops for that fresh, pawis-free vibe.
▢ Board shorts for beach adventures in Boracay, Siquijor, Siargao, etc.
▢ Lightweight pants for hiking Mount Pulag, Mount Apo, Mount Pinatubo, etc.
▢ A light jacket for chilly Baguio or Sagada nights.
Footwear Fit for Travel Kings
Your man packing list isn’t complete without the right kicks:
▢ Sneakers for city strolls.
▢ Flip-flops or slippers for beach walks and hotel use.
▢ Hiking boots or hiking sandals for mountain trails.

Toiletries and Grooming Essentials
Stay Fresh, Smell Good, and Look Sharp
Not all accommodations provide toiletries, especially when you’re staying at a budget hotel, Airbnb, transient, or homestay. Also, make sure that all bottles are less than 100ml if you’re flying with hand-carry luggage only.
Your packing list for guys should scream fresh:
▢ Waterproof pouch for your toiletries
▢ Toothbrush and toothpaste.
▢ Shampoo sachet and small soap bar.
▢ Deodorant – because pawis happens.
▢ Perfume or cologne to keep that smell good energy.
▢ Razor and grooming kit for that fresh look.
▢ Portable bath towel so that you can take a shower.

Bags
▢ Duffel bag or backpack for weekend trips.
▢ Small body bag for all your necessities.
▢ 7kg hand-carry luggage for 3 to 4 nights of stay.
▢ 20kg check-in luggage for 5 or more nights of stay.
Tip: Make sure to check airline restrictions in terms of size. There are airports and airlines that are strict in terms of luggage size and weight.
AirAsia has recently become more strict with the size of your hand-carry luggage. We’ve seen people have their hand carries checked in because of the incorrect cabin bag size and overweight baggage.
Make sure it’s strictly 7kg for both bags. And make sure your cabin bag doesn’t exceed the 56cm height, including the wheels.
The size are as follows:
- 56x36x23cm for hand-carry rolling luggage.
- 30x40x10cm for personal bag.

Sunlight Air also has a smaller hand-carry bag size requirement. You’re only allowed to bring a rolling luggage of 35x40x20cm.
Take note that that’s smaller than the regular 56cm hand-carry rolling luggage.

In our experience, Cebu Pacific and Philippine Airlines (PAL) are more lenient in terms of hand-carry luggage. But we suggest that you still follow the 7kg weight limit for hand-carry luggage.
You don’t want to buy extra check-in luggage at the airport just because you are too complacent. That’s extra gastos!
